Number coding in the National Capital Region will remain suspended under Alert Level 4, which was extended until Oct. 15, the MMDA said Friday.
"Sa pagpasok ng buwan ng Oktubre, nananatili pa ring suspendido ang Unified Vehicular Volume Reduction Program (UVVRP) o number coding scheme," the MMDA said in an advisory.
The suspension is in effect until further notice. Makati City, which implemented number coding under Alert Level 4, is yet to suspend the scheme.
Alert Level 4 is the second highest classification under the alert-based quarantine system that is being piloted in the capital region of 12 million people. Granular lockdowns in streets and brangays are implemented to allow businesses to open.
